On average across the year,
no, Bellingham, Washington is not hotter than
Renton, Washington
.
Bellingham, Washington has an average temperature of 11°C/52°F and Renton, Washington has an average temperature of 12°C/54°F.
Bellingham, Washington's hottest month is August, with an average maximum temperature of 24°C/75°F, which is not hotter than Renton, Washington's hottest month (also August, with an average maximum temperature of 26°C/79°F).
On average across the year, yes, Bellingham, Washington is colder than Renton, Washington . Bellingham, Washington has an average minimum temperature of 7°C/45°F and Renton, Washington has an average minimum temperature of 8°C/46°F.
On average across the year,
no, Bellingham, Washington has less rain than
Renton, Washington. Bellingham, Washington has an average annual rainfall of 991mm and Renton, Washington has an average annual rainfall of 1094mm.
Bellingham, Washington's wettest month is November, with an average monthly rainfall of 161mm, which is drier than Renton, Washington's wettest month (also November, with an average monthly rainfall of 166mm).
